Another cool night; low of 38°. Today’s weather will mirror the last few days, staying cooler and partly cloudy.  Today we are hiking from  VA 670 (526.4 NoBo) to VA 603, Fox Creek (512.6 NoBo) for a total of 13.8 miles. Today’s hike put us over 600 trail miles  πŸ₯³. We began hiking at 8:15 am. A group of Virginia Tech students were backpacking off the trail as we started. They didn’t look too happy! Creek crossing at Comers Creek.  The original bridge was washed out. The Appalachian Trail Conservancy  is in the process of rebuilding the bridge so there was an alternate route to use up to Dickey Gap or  you could take the normal trail and cross at your own risk. Water levels have dropped the past few days so we decided to take the regular trail.    The rhododendrons didn’t blossom before we left the trail. The weather forecast surprisingly has been 100% accurate 3 days in a row! Woke up to a chilly 36° and partly sunny skies.  Three months ago we were praying for 36° temperatures now we dread it πŸ₯ΆπŸ˜¬.  Today we are hiking from  VA 615, Lindawood School (542.9 NoBo) to VA 670 (526.4 NoBo) for a total of 16.5 miles.  We arrive at our parking location to find a Trail Angel there providing any and all supply’s imaginable to AT hikers - was like a mini outfitter.   The trail magic, which is free,  was sponsored by the Sugar Grove Baptist Church. They provided  the trail magic every weekend from April through September since 1917.  The person managing the trail magic did not have a trail name so we called him “Preacher”. Turtle and I enjoyed a nice fresh cup of coffee. It’s amazing how many communities along the trail cater to the hikers.
